I enjoyed this game and was happy to buy it at launch. But the dev decided to turn it from a paid game into a free game with ads and then forcing paid customers to pay again. I can't support this. It doesn't matter how many dollars it was at launch, I'm sure if you stole an item from a store the police wouldn't care how much it cost. It's still theft except here its the store going to your house and taking back what you already paid for. I bought a game without ads, what it turned into I'll never support. I bought this game a year ago and it was great. Now I play and I'm constantly assaulted with ads. It even has a banner ad across the top of the screen when I'm in a level. It also regularly crashes when I close an ad so I can play a level.
